The Impact of Energy Savings
What if we still consumed energy at the same rate we did in 2000?• In 2008, our expenses would have been $856,000 higher.
The environmental impact?• This reduction in energy consumption has reduced our Greenhouse Gas Emissions (CO2) by 6,400 Metric Tons per year.

The Impact of Water Savings
• Avoided Cost of $298,000 for 2008• Savings of 23 Million Gallons
Annually• What we are doing to reduce further:
– Installing low-flow toilets• Savings of 2.3 million gallons and $46,000
annually; 47% IRR)
– Planning to divert condensate and rain-water to our cooling towers.
• Potential savings of 8 million gallons and $154,000 per year

American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 (ARRA)
Potential Funding for GA $82,495,000
Monies controlled in GA by GEFA – Georgia Environmental Facilities Authority
“Under the 2009 State Energy Program, GEFA intends to create several funding opportunities for state agencies, local governments, and private-sector entities. Opportunities for the private-sector will include loans and grants, and will be awarded through an open, competitive application process. Applications will be evaluated according to a series of criteria still under development. Criteria may include, but not limited to, estimates of job creation / retention, other economic benefits, energy saved, renewable energy generated, and other cost/benefit information”
